Based on your other post, that was the Dock icon, which is just an alias to your Home folder-> Documents


From the Finder look in your home folder, and just click and drag the Documents folder to where it was on the Dock.


While dragging, DO NOT let this drag go into the trash, as this is the real Documents folder.


Once you have your Dock Documents icon, you can Control-Click on the icon to set how you want it to display.
